Transaction 59474f999da429ea4415fc977942b68a904df0db852798be29d110f3367d609d

1 Input
2 Outputs
  • 59474f999da429ea4415fc977942b68a904df0db852798be29d110f3367d609d:0
  • value  17780382
    address  16P1qxR4z335TCYYAi1tUNwmTQKPrQCg4V
  • 59474f999da429ea4415fc977942b68a904df0db852798be29d110f3367d609d:1
  • value  100487357
    address  1279QHHxpdh3WbDRQiiWowvqDTeWZ3jH6k